Output 3cfaf1c3eebba1263e596918a42ce7a69107f3512ea041579c3192515b58718b:0

value
1248994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f9e13b15ef7aa9e484f31325241226f577f48c OP_EQUAL
address
39M3MRG7Tqms3wrwZbhePkxi1umcGQvFfP
transaction
3cfaf1c3eebba1263e596918a42ce7a69107f3512ea041579c3192515b58718b
spent
true